Man has always sought to find "brothers in reason" or to find the same planet as our Earth. Even in the works of the writer of the 2nd century, Lucian of Samosata, the meeting of people with the inhabitants of the moon was described. Thanks to the discoveries of Copernicus and Galileo, this topic again became popular in the Renaissance.

About countless worlds spoke Giordano Bruno. Adventurers flew to the moon in the works of Cyrano de Bergerac and Jules Verne. Voltaire expressed his assumptions about life on other planets. For the most part, great thinkers and writers expressed theoretical assumptions without any confirmed facts.

This summer, an international group of astronomers announced the discovery of a unique exoplanet called GJ 357 d. Scientists have defined it as a "potentially inhabited world" outside of our solar system. The fitness of the celestial body for life consists of several data: the presence of liquid water, the atmosphere, chemical diversity and a "star named the Sun."

Associate Professor of Astronomy Lisa Kaltenegger is convinced that with the help of telescopes it will be possible to make out traces of life. The planet contains a dense atmosphere, thanks to which it has water. This allows you to compare it with the Earth.

In an article in the journal Astronomy and Astrophysics, scientists talked about how a planet is about twice the size of Earth and has a lot more weight. The "Super Earth", as it is also called, lives in a distant galaxy where a small sun shines. At the same time, the size of the star is three times smaller than ours.

In addition to the discovered GJ 357 d, three more planets rotate nearby. The temperature on the surface of the super-earth is heated to 127 degrees Celsius. It revolves around its small sun and the rotation period is 55 days on Earth. Scientists noted that there are chemicals on the planet such as H2O, CO2, CH4, O3 and O2.

Lisa Kaltenegger noted that research will provide an opportunity to test new theories and models.

Reported exoplanets have been reported before. So, in 2009, NASA launched the Kepler apparatus, aimed at finding them.
On April 17, 2014, the agency announced the discovery of the exoplanet Kepler-186f in the constellation Cygnus. But life on it is most likely absent. The fact is that she is spinning around a red dwarf. So they designate the sun, which does not warm. In 2017, it was announced that three planets in the TRAPPIST-1 system with water and atmosphere were identified. In the same year, experts said they found oceans on a satellite of Saturn, Enceladus, under a layer of ice.
